What is the Code Enforcement Tracking Form?
The Code Enforcement Tracking Form is a critical document utilized in the City of Winters to oversee and manage code violations. This form serves multiple key stakeholders, including the reporting person, property owner, and city officials, providing a structured approach to ensure compliance with local regulations.
This form encapsulates essential information that aids in documenting code violations effectively. Its significance lies in facilitating transparency and accountability in maintaining community standards.

Who is eligible to use the Code Enforcement Tracking Form?
Any person wishing to report a code violation or property owners responding to these violations are eligible to fill out the Code Enforcement Tracking Form.
What is the submission process for the form?
The completed Code Enforcement Tracking Form can typically be submitted via mail or directly to the City of Winters' City Clerk office. Be sure to verify specific submission guidelines.
Are supporting documents required with this form?
Yes, it may be beneficial to include any relevant documentation such as photographs, prior notices, or communications related to the violation when submitting the form for better context.
How long does it take for a submitted form to be processed?
Processing times can vary, but generally, you can expect a response within two to four weeks after submission. It's advisable to reach out to the City Clerk's office for more precise timelines.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Common mistakes include leaving fields blank, failing to sign the form, and not providing sufficient detail regarding the violation. Double-check all entries before submitting.
When is the best time to submit the Code Enforcement Tracking Form?
It's best to submit the form as soon as you notice a code violation. Prompt reporting can aid in quicker enforcement and resolution by city officials.
Is notarization required for this form?
No, notarization is not required for the Code Enforcement Tracking Form, making it easier for individuals to submit complaints without additional hurdles.
